The protein encoded by this gene is a member of the dual specificity protein kinase family, which acts as a mitogen-activated protein (MAP) kinase kinase. MAP kinases, also known as extracellular signal-regulated kinases (ERKs), act as an integration point for multiple biochemical signals. This protein kinase lies upstream of MAP kinases and stimulates the enzymatic activity of MAP kinases upon wide variety of extra- and intracellular signals. As an essential component of MAP kinase signal transduction pathway, this kinase is involved in many cellular processes such as proliferation, differentiation, transcription regulation and development.

Western blot analysis of various lysates using Phospho-MEK1-S298 Rabbit pAb (CABP0063) at 1:1000 dilution or MEK1 antibody (CAB12687). HeLa cells were treated with PMA/TPA (200 nM) at 37℃ for 15 minutes after serum-starvation overnight or treated with ATP(5 mM) at 30℃ for 1 hour. Secondary antibody: HRP-conjugated Goat anti-Rabbit IgG (H+L) (CABS014) at 1:10000 dilution. Lysates/proteins: 25μg per lane. Blocking buffer: 3% BSA. Detection: ECL Basic Kit (AbGn00020). Exposure time: 1s.
Western blot analysis of various lysates using Phospho-MEK1-S298 Rabbit pAb (CABP0063) at 1:1000 dilution. C2C12 cells were treated with CIP(20uL/400ul) at 37℃ for 1 hour or treated with ATP(5 mM) at 30℃ for 1 hour. C6 cells were treated with CIP(20uL/400ul) at 37℃ for 1 hour or treated with ATP(5 mM) at 30℃ for 1 hour. Secondary antibody: HRP-conjugated Goat anti-Rabbit IgG (H+L) (CABS014) at 1:10000 dilution. Lysates/proteins: 25μg per lane. Blocking buffer: 3% BSA. Detection: ECL Basic Kit (AbGn00020). Exposure time: 1s.
